The book "Indian Polity" by M Laxmikant provides an in-depth analysis of the Indian Constitution, which is the foundation of the country's polity. It explains the fundamental principles of governance, the structure of the government, and the role of various institutions such as the Parliament, the Executive, and the Judiciary. The author also discusses the relationships between the Centre and the states, the powers of the Governor, and the role of the Election Commission.
